NEW DELHI: In a strategic business tie up, the CEO of ATD Group, Manoranjan Mohanty has joined hands with Professor Ranjan Mohapatra to elevate the CSR activities and promote sustainable movement in India.
The newly amended companies Act 2013 has many new provisions, a key amendment is about mandatory CSR provision, where a set of companies qualifying few parameters are mandated to spend 2 % of their profit in activities to benefit the society and the environment.
After, the law was passed and became effective from 1st April, 2014 awareness about CSR has grown. The growth in awareness has increased also due to the pronouncements of the PM, in his very first Independence Day speech from the Red Fort.
However, all the awareness about CSR is limited to 2% of profit. The CSR eligible companies are concerned about spending or managing the CSR fund and comply with the law. The NGOs and other CSR implementing agencies are concerned about, how to get a piece of the CSR cake / CSR budget.
